How should a common data source like social media comments be categorized? 1 structured data 2 unstructured data 3 temporary data 4 dirty data

Answers

Common data sources like social media comments are categorized as unstructured data. (Option 2)

Unstructured data refers to information that does not have a pre-defined data model or is not organized in a pre-defined manner. Unstructured data is a dataset that is not stored in a specific structured format and is generally text-heavy, but may contain data such as dates, numbers, and facts. Unstructured data does have an internal structure, but it is not predefined through data models. It might be human generated, or machine generated in a textual or a non-textual format. Examples of unstructured data are social media comments, blog posts, videos, and documents.

you are to enclose a rectangular garden with 180 yards of fencing. what dimensions (width and length) for the garden will maximize the area? what is the area with these dimensions?

Answers

Dimensions of the rectangular garden are 45 yards each and area with  the calculated dimensions are 2025 square yards.

As given in the question,

Perimeter of the rectangular garden is equal to 180 yards

Let 'x' be the length and 'y' be the width of the rectangular garden

2 ( x + y ) = 180

⇒ x + y = 90

⇒ y = 90 -x

Area of the rectangular garden 'A' = xy

⇒ A = x ( 90 - x)

⇒ A = 90x - x²

To maximize the area dA/dx = 0

dA/dx = 90 - 2x

⇒ 90 - 2x = 0

⇒ 2x = 90

⇒ x = 45 yards

⇒ y = 45 yards

Area of the rectangular garden = 45 × 45

                                                 = 2025 square yards

Therefore, the dimensions of the garden are 45 yards each and area of the rectangular garden is equal to 2025 square yards.

First Derivative Test vs Second Derivative Test for Local Extrema

Answers

The First Derivative Test for Local Extrema is the name of the procedure when it is used to find the values of the local maximum or minimum function.

The second derivative may be used to determine the local extrema of a function under certain conditions.

A function is said to have a local (relative) extremum at a critical point if the derivative of the function changes sign near that location. At the critical point, the function has a local (relative) maximum if the derivative switches from being positive (growing function) to negative (decreasing function). The function, however, has a local (relative) minimum at the critical point if the derivative switches from negative (decreasing function) to positive (growing function). The First Derivative Test for Local Extrema is the name of the procedure when it is used to find the values of the local maximum or minimum function.

Under certain circumstances, one can utilize the second derivative to identify the local extrema of a function. A function has a local minimum at this point if it has a critical point when f′(x) = 0 and the second derivative is positive. However, if the function contains a critical point at which the second derivative is negative and f′(x) = 0, then f has a local maximum at this location. The Second Derivative Test for Local Extrema is the name of this method.

A carpenter used 29 ft of molding in three pieces to trim a garage door. If the
long piece was 1 ft longer than twice the length of each shorter piece, then
how long was each piece?

Answers

Answer:

Let's call the length of the long piece x, and the length of each shorter piece y. We can set up the following equation to represent the problem:

x + 2y = 29

Since the long piece is 1 ft longer than twice the length of each shorter piece, we can write this equation as:

x = 2y + 1

Substituting this expression for x in the first equation, we get:

2y + 1 + 2y = 29

Combining like terms on both sides, we get:

4y + 1 = 29

Subtracting 1 from both sides, we get:

4y = 28

Dividing both sides by 4, we get:

y = 7

Substituting this value for y in the expression for x, we get:

x = 2(7) + 1 = 14 + 1 = 15

Thus, the length of the long piece is 15 ft, and the length of each shorter piece is 7 ft.
